Difficulty: Easy to moderate (a steep section) Distance: 3.9km each way (including the final ridge) Elevation: 359 metres Type of trail: Out and back trail Time taken: 2-2.5 hours total (both ways). The Parker Ridge Trail gently climbs through second-growth forest for about a mile before rising steeply over three ledges and continuing on a steady ascent of Parker Ridge. The trail is short (2.7 km-- about 1.7 mi) and climbs about 250 m (about 800'), with most of the climbing at the start as the trail quickly gets above the sparse tree cover around the trailhead and then bends southeast. The trail does not actually reach the summit of Parker Ridge, but it comes within about 60 vertical meters of it. While nearly all hikers stop right where the trail reaches the ridge top, this hike can be very substantially extended, at least doubling the hike, by continuing west along the very ridge top toward nearby Mt. Parker Ridge Trail is located near Saskatchewan River Crossing, in the northern end of Banff National Park, in the province of Alberta. The Parker Ridge Trail trailhead is found at a large, well-marked parking area along the Icefields Parkway (Hwy 93).
